Once again, Bangkok Quilt Group contributed 4 quilts to Habitat for Humanity. International School Bangkok students went on a week without walls trip, one group to Udon Thani and one group to Chiang Mai to build houses. Each family was presented with a quilt to welcome them into their new homes. Thank you to the Manga group for finishing the quilts by tying them with embroidery floss so nicely! As Mimosas do Pasatempo Originally uploaded by Breixo Pazos On March 8, 1908 a group of American women went on strike and locked themselves into a factory where they were working. All they wanted were equal rights and wages. The owner of the factory decided to teach them a lesson and set fire to the factory. They were trapped inside and killed. In Italy Women’s Day is celebrated as the Festa della Donna. I believe it was originally celebrated in memory of these women martyrs, but now...
